What are the average costs of home inspectors in Guelph?

Home inspectors in Guelph typically offer comprehensive property assessments that cover everything from the foundation to the roof, identifying potential issues before they become costly problems. On average, home inspections in Guelph generally cost from $300 to $600 for standard inspections, but prices can vary based on factors like property size, location, and the type of inspection services you require.

For house inspections in Guelph, expect to pay:

  • Construction project calculations: $500 to $2,500

  • Mold remediation: $500 to $6,000

  • Energy audits: $300 to $600

  • Home inspection: $300 to $600

  • Land surveying: $500 to $2,500

  • Remove asbestos: $1,000 to $3,000+

  • Structural engineer: $100 to $300 per hour

  • Water removal recovery service: $500 to $5,000+

  • Water inspections: $150 to $400

What to ask a Guelph home inspector before hiring?

Here are some questions to ask home inspectors in Guelph and the answers that suggest they’re the right fit for your project.

How long have you been working as a home inspector in Guelph, and what certifications do you hold?

A home inspector in Guelph should be able to outline their years of experience in the industry. Look for certifications from recognized organizations, such as the Canadian Association of Home & Property Inspectors (CAHPI) or InterNACHI (International Association of Certified Home Inspectors). These certifications ensure that the inspector is trained and follows industry standards for thorough inspections.

Do you offer a detailed report after the inspection?

Every home inspector in Guelph should provide a comprehensive house inspection report, detailing any issues found, from minor repairs to major structural concerns. The report should include photos, descriptions of problems, and suggested solutions. Ask if the report will be delivered digitally and whether it’s easy to understand, as well as whether it will be available the same day or after a few days.

Will you inspect the property's major systems and components?

Ask if the Guelph home inspector will check all major systems and components of the home, such as the foundation, roof, plumbing, electrical system, heating/cooling, and insulation. The right home inspector in Guelph will go beyond a visual check, using tools like moisture meters and thermal cameras to assess hidden issues like water damage or electrical problems.

How do you approach inspecting older homes?

Older homes often come with unique challenges, such as outdated wiring, plumbing, or structural issues. Home inspectors in Guelph should have experience inspecting houses of various ages and be familiar with the specific challenges that come with older properties. They should also know how to assess the age and condition of older materials like lead-based paint or asbestos.

How long will the inspection take, and when can you start?

Expect a Guelph house inspection to take anywhere from 2 to 4 hours, depending on the size and condition of the home. The right Guelph home inspector should provide you with a clear timeline, including when they are available to start the inspection. This is especially important if you’re working with tight timelines, such as during a real estate transaction.

FAQ: Common questions about home inspectors in Guelph

Do home inspectors in Guelph offer any guarantees or warranties for their services?

While home inspectors in Guelph do their best to provide accurate assessments, it's important to understand that no inspector can guarantee the absence of future issues. However, some home inspectors offer a limited warranty on certain aspects of the inspection, such as coverage for certain repairs or issues that may arise within a short period.

Can a home inspector in Guelph help me with repairs after the inspection?

Guelph house inspectors are typically not involved in the repair process. Their role is to provide an unbiased, professional assessment of the property's condition. However, many home inspectors can recommend contractors or specialists who can handle repairs.

Can home inspectors in Guelph inspect for environmental hazards like radon or asbestos?

Yes, many house inspectors in Guelph offer specialized testing for environmental hazards, including radon, asbestos, and lead. If you're concerned about these hazards, be sure to ask if they can perform additional tests or if they can refer you to a specialist. Additional fees may apply for these tests, so it's best to discuss them upfront.

What should I do if the Guelph house inspector finds major issues during the inspection?

If the home inspector in Guelph identifies significant issues, they will typically include these in their report along with recommendations for repairs, further evaluations, or quotes from contractors. You’ll want to consider these findings when negotiating the sale price, asking the seller for repairs, or deciding whether to move forward with the purchase. You may also want to consult with structural engineers or contractors for more in-depth assessments.
